Almost One
When I felt your touch for the first time
I instantly wanted you for mine
Tingles of electricity leaping through me
Unspoken promises of things to be
Time spent in heavens hands
Days and nights on beaches sand
Like the water with the rising tide
I loved you with everything inside
A love to never be undone
Passing days souls growing into one
Love that runs so deep and true
My heart being given to you
I gave myself clear and free
For all the world to undoubtedly see
That you were my one and only love
As surely as the clouds drifting above
I never expected to get my heart back
I thought you'd hold it eternally intact
I stand drenched in tears like rain
Never before have I known such pain
One soul returning to face life alone
How could I have ever known
That love given so pure and true
Would one day be returned by you
The hurt it fades as time goes on
The pain never completely gone
Memories like the setting sun
Two souls that were almost one
